Action item 4 (owner: on-call): the Quillbase wiki granted editor rights to stale role-sync entries because cache expiry outlasted the upstream revocation window. Tighten the sync cadence and shrink the permission cache TTL so revocations land within one page-load cycle. Verify under load that the shorter TTL doesn't overwhelm the directory service. The proposed replacement constants are listed below for sign-off.

constants for tageg-kagag:
QUOTAS = {
    "kelax": 495,
    "istath": 366,
    "tammir": 108,
    "novdor": 730,
    "casax": 816,
    "quenael": 874,
    "pelius": 403,
}

### Changelog — Quillsearch 4.2

The nightly reindex job now defaults to incremental mode instead of full rebuilds. Plugin authors relying on a complete nightly pass should declare `full_rebuild` in their manifest. Batch size and tokenizer cache limits have also changed; plugins with custom analyzers may see different warm-up behavior.

The new default values shipped with this release are listed below.

service settings:
[pelius]
port = 5432
team = praius
host = pelius.crelvoforge.internal
region = upper-4
access_code = ac_8f224d
timeout_ms = 2000

Migration Guide — Step 4: Chip Reader Service

For the Corvel Bay Marathon cutover, the Fenwick-series timing mats now report to the new ReaderHub daemon instead of the legacy collector. Install the daemon on the finish-line gateway, confirm the antenna array enumerates all eight mats, and verify heartbeat intervals before race day. Once the service starts cleanly, apply the production configuration shown below.

config for tagep-yajef:
ulawyn:
  log_level: error
  metrics_host: metrics.ulawyn.lumiclabs.internal
  pin: 0564
  pool_size: 32